Sunday 24th July  2011 15.06hrs

The team was paged while attending Catfield Village Fete to two persons in trouble in the water at Popular farm Waxham. Happisburgh Coastguard Rescue Team was first on scene and found the two Lads had been helped to the shore by members of the public. They stabilized the casualties who had swallowed water and had cuts and bruises until the Ambulance arrived. RAF  Rescue Helicopter Rescue 125 air lifted the two boys and took them to the James Paget Hospital to be checked over.

Reports of a vessel that has hit an object and run aground Cart Gap, Left station for Cart Gap, a survey boat about 30ft long had hit a groin and had a 6 feet by 1 feet hole in the starboard side and ran up the beach before it sunk, there were 3 POB on board, stood by vessel till low tide till shore help arrived then escorted it off the beach.

General Advice

• Always swim close to the beach in line with the shore.

• Do not drink and drown - eating and drinking before swimming may give you cramps while you are in the water – you may then be unable to get back to the shore.

• Drinking Alcohol and going in the sea is dangerous, it slows your reactions, increase chances of hypothermia and your judgment of distance will be impaired

• Check the weather and tides before you leave home.

• Always wear sun cream, at least factor 15 or above, sunbathe for short periods of time, use after tan lotion and wear loose clothing that covers your arms and legs to prevent further exposure.

• Keep young children within your sight at all times.
